#273376 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#273376 is composed of 15.3% red, 20%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.9%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 230.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 30.8%. #273376 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e66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#273376 color description : Dark moderate blue.

#273376 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#273376 has RGB values of R:39, G:51,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 2569078.

Shades and Tints of #273376

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f2f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#273376

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4c52 is the less saturated color, while #031a9a is the most saturated one.
